On Abyssinia Cyber Gateway I have found this page about a scroll of paper
that seem to be the only existing example of a mysterious writing system,
apparently accompanied by an Arabic translation:


I have read the article but I am not quite sure how I should interpret it.
Is it writing or some sort of magical pseudo-text?

Thanks for any info.
_ Marco